Following Clinical Research is Essential for Practicing Pharmacists
Because health care is a constantly evolving field, research pharmacist Brian Wortz, PharmD, of Cancer Treatment Centers of America, said pharmacists must be aware of the newest findings and how they could impact their patients.

Not only is this important, but Wortz said that pharmacists are perfectly positioned to be at the forefront of pharmaceutical research.
